From 9a269899a07e0fc42c5395f9ec5e8bfd04f29c24 Mon Sep 17 00:00:00 2001 From: tsutsui Date: Sun, 27 Aug 2006 06:04:12 +0000 Subject: [PATCH] Avoid unneeded sign extension. --- sys/arch/newsmips/newsmips/news3400.c | 12 ++++++------ 1 file changed, 6 insertions(+), 6 deletions(-) diff --git a/sys/arch/newsmips/newsmips/news3400.c b/sys/arch/newsmips/newsmips/news3400.c index 6b8af6513261..4bec947f6968 100644 --- a/sys/arch/newsmips/newsmips/news3400.c +++ b/sys/arch/newsmips/newsmips/news3400.c @@ -1,4 +1,4 @@ -/* $NetBSD: news3400.c,v 1.17 2006/08/27 05:25:47 tsutsui Exp $ */ +/* $NetBSD: news3400.c,v 1.18 2006/08/27 06:04:12 tsutsui Exp $ */ /*- * Copyright (C) 1999 Tsubai Masanari. All rights reserved. @@ -27,7 +27,7 @@ */ #include -__KERNEL_RCSID(0, "$NetBSD: news3400.c,v 1.17 2006/08/27 05:25:47 tsutsui Exp $"); +__KERNEL_RCSID(0, "$NetBSD: news3400.c,v 1.18 2006/08/27 06:04:12 tsutsui Exp $"); #include #include @@ -183,19 +183,19 @@ news3400_level1_intr(void) int news3400_badaddr(void *addr, u_int size) { - volatile int x; + volatile u_int x; badaddr_flag = 0; switch (size) { case 1: - x = *(volatile int8_t *)addr; + x = *(volatile uint8_t *)addr; break; case 2: - x = *(volatile int16_t *)addr; + x = *(volatile uint16_t *)addr; break; case 4: - x = *(volatile int32_t *)addr; + x = *(volatile uint32_t *)addr; break; }